How they compare

Indonesia currently reports 6.26 kg CO2eq/Int$ against 6.17 kg CO2eq/Int$ in Belarus, a difference of 0.09 kg CO2eq/Int$.

The two have swapped places 12 times across 30 shared years of data; in 1994 it was Indonesia ahead.

Belarus ranks 41st and Indonesia ranks 40th of 184 countries.

Across the 4 decades both report, Belarus averaged higher in 1 and Indonesia in 3.

Head to head by decade

Decade Belarus Indonesia Difference Ahead
1990s 9.03 kg CO2eq/Int$ 33.41 kg CO2eq/Int$ 24.38 kg CO2eq/Int$ Indonesia
2000s 7.73 kg CO2eq/Int$ 11.49 kg CO2eq/Int$ 3.76 kg CO2eq/Int$ Indonesia
2010s 6.63 kg CO2eq/Int$ 8.16 kg CO2eq/Int$ 1.53 kg CO2eq/Int$ Indonesia
2020s 6.19 kg CO2eq/Int$ 4.69 kg CO2eq/Int$ 1.5 kg CO2eq/Int$ Belarus

Averages of every year both report within each decade.

The FAOSTAT domain on Emissions indicators disseminates indicators on sectoral shares of total national greenhouse gas (GHG) emissions as well as three indicators of emissions intensity: per capita emissions; emissions per value of agricultural production; and emissions per area of agricultural land.
